Beside above, what is the difference between a problem and an opportunity?
Problem vs.
Problem-focused projects must first determine the cause of the problem then determine how to solve it. Opportunities, on the other hand, are initiatives that will assist the organization in reaching business goals and objectives if implemented appropriately.
